Connectors - Connecting, Disconnecting and Repairing

Removing
- Disengage connector lock using a small screwdriver and pull open (arrow)






NOTE: Connector can be removed only when connector lock is open.


- Remove connector from instrument cluster.

Installing
- Fully insert connector onto instrument cluster.
- Push connector lock down until locked.

26-point connectors on instrument cluster, repairing





Damaged or loose 26-point connector terminals can be repaired without replacing the entire wiring harness. Use connector terminal repair kit part no. 893 998 315.


CAUTION!
Part numbers are for reference only. Always check with your parts department for latest information.



- Disengage connector lock -A- and pull open.
- Remove 26-point connector from instrument cluster.
- Remove connector tie-wrap -C-.
- Remove inner connector housing -D- from outer connector housing -B-.
- Remove damaged terminal -E- from housing -D-.
- Install small end of new terminal/wire assembly (from repair kit part no. 893 998 315) into proper location of inner connector housing -D-.
- Install other end of new terminal/wire assembly into position 1 of new two-point connector housing, part no. 893 971 632 (from repair kit).


NOTE: The new two-point connectors have numbers 1 and 2 stamped on the housing to identify each terminal position. Always match position 1 of one connector to position 1 of the other connector when inserting terminals.


- Cut damaged terminal -E- from harness wire.
- Properly crimp new spade terminal (from repair kit) onto harness wire.
- Insert new spade terminal into position 1 of new two-point connector housing, part no. 893 971 992 (from repair kit).
- Install new connector housings together.
- Install inner connector housing -D- into outer connector housing -B-.
- Install tie wrap -C-.
- Secure repaired wire and new connectors to wire harness with tie wrap and insulate harness to prevent rattles.
- Fully insert connector into instrument cluster.
- Push down connector lock -A- until locked.
